Whimsical Home Accents Abound by These Global Makers
Artists explore conceptual and material dichotomies via disparate mediums—from soft fibers to hard ceramics, fragile glass to indestructible metal.
Piecework Funnel and Crewel Basket porcelain vessels by Philadelphia-based ceramics atelier Leah Kaplan Studio
Pooja Pawaskar’s Side-by-Side mirror with wood frame by Ottawa, Canada-based Whirl & Whittle
Bottleheads handblown glass pieces with sculpted bitwork by Rochester, New York–based glassblower/sculptor Elizabeth Lyons through LES Collection
Vertigo handbuilt object in satin-matte-finish white stoneware clay with colored underglaze by New York–based ceramics studio Colleen Carlson Design
Oakland, California–based Kieu Tran’s In Transition sculpture in glazed stoneware by Studio Kieu
Lee Series Blackrock sculpture in unbleached canvas by Mary Little
Italian jeweler Monica Castiglioni’s Emoji series Lino vases in Bordeaux enamel by Ceramiche Rometti
Lace on Madder artwork in natural dye–derived watercolor on handwoven linen by Los Angeles–based textile artist Rachel Duvall

Low Snake ceramic stoneware lamp by Los Angeles–based ceramicist Eric Roinestad through The Future Perfect
Jana and Tanner Roach’s Mushroom stool/side tables handmade of sustainably and ethically sourced fir, larch, birch, and other woods by Kalispell, Montana–based Beck & Cap
Doubt in wool and cotton by Kingston, New York–based textile artist Kat Howard

Illumination Machine in cast iron and glass by Alpha, New Jersey–based designer Brecht Wright Gander through Emma Scully Gallery
